Handover Note — Pricing Directorate

To the heads of department, from outgoing director Pell Varga to incoming director Sunna Dreis.

Legacy-tier customers on the Cobalt Ledger platform move to the new rate card on 1 March. Increase is 9% average, capped at 12% per account. Comms templates are approved; retention offers are pre-cleared for the top fifty accounts. Expect pushback from the Halveston region. Monitor churn weekly. The rationale and next phase are covered in the confidential note below.

board note of kajof-yajof: Aldethox Systems is in early talks to buy Holielek Partners for about $15.4 million. The Keleth launch date is August 21, and nothing goes to the press before then.

PortionCraft is our recipe-scaling calculator, exposed to internal kitchens only. Three environments exist: dev, staging, and production, each isolated in its own network segment with no shared credentials. Staging mirrors production topology but uses synthetic recipe data, so no proprietary formulations are at risk there. Access to production requires membership in the culinary-ops group and passes through the Brindlemoor bastion. For review purposes, the production environment runs with the following configuration values.

config for kafof-bawef:
holath:
  log_level: debug
  metrics_host: metrics.holath.qorvelsys.internal
  pin: 2191
  pool_size: 32

Postmortem timeline, 14:05 — Load test against the Tillford checkout flow reached 800 requests per second, at which point the payment stub began queueing and cart confirmations lagged by up to 40 seconds. Support saw a spike in "order pending" tickets during this window; all affected orders eventually completed and no charges were duplicated. The test was halted at 14:22 and queues drained by 14:31. The test run is recorded under the trace below.

pipeline stamp: htk31_f769b577b3028a4e9958e5bb8d1259a

If a tenant on Quillform reports slow page loads, first check the template render timings in the Lathemark dashboard. Renders over 800 ms usually indicate an unbounded partial loop; escalate those to engineering. To pull per-tenant render traces yourself, query the Lathemark trace endpoint directly, authenticating with the internal support key shown below.

API key for yahig-tadup: kto7_ubizbYm